I’m surprised our captain stamped a player to get a red card against Hearts of Oak – Nsoatreman GM

Published on: 26 September 2023

Nsoatreman FC general manager, Eric Aligidede, has expressed his surprise at what his captain, Philip Ofori, did to be sent off against Hearts of Oak.

The defender stamped a player and was shown a straight red card in the game as they suffered their first defeat of the season.

The centre back was sent off after only 34 minutes into the Ghana Premier League week two fixture against the Phobians on Sunday at the Accra Sports Stadium.

Nsoatreman went on to play with ten men for the remainder of the game and lost 1-0 to the Phobians.

Reacting to the incident leading to the red card, Alagidede said on a normal day Philip will not do what he did.

“Philip is one of our most dependable center backs. Wearing the captain’s armband, I don’t know what really came over him because on a normal day Philip would not do that.

“I am a bit surprised he did something like that. In all even with ten men, we gave Hearts of Oak a good run for their money.”
